This is a page from a Missale (Catholic missal) printed in Paris in 1519 by Franciscum Regnault. The title reads "Missale ad usum ecclesie Sarisburiensis" (Missal according to the use of Salisbury). The page features an elaborate layout with a central woodcut illustration surrounded by decorative borders containing smaller religious scenes. The main central illustration depicts a religious scene with multiple figures in a Gothic architectural setting. The text is printed in black and red (rubrication), using Gothic typeface typical of early 16th-century printing. The decorative border consists of multiple small woodcut panels showing various religious figures and scenes. At the bottom of the page is an ornate architectural border piece with flowing decorative elements including foliage and mythological creatures. This missal is a fine example of early 16th-century French printing and religious book design, combining traditional medieval manuscript decoration styles with Renaissance printing techniques. The level of detail in both the illustrations and typography demonstrates the high quality of Parisian printing during this period.
